Cultural Impact and Influence of Niska in French Rap
Niska, a leading figure in French rap, transcends the boundaries of musical stages to profoundly influence popular culture. Signed to Universal Music, the rapper continues to leave his mark on the music world. His song ‘Réseaux’, a manifesto of a hyper-connected generation, has achieved resounding success, symbolizing the artist’s ability to capture the spirit of the times.
Niska’s artistic collaborations with prominent names such as Booba, Gradur, and Maître Gims reveal his considerable influence and versatility in the industry. These strategic alliances have allowed him to diversify his audience and strengthen his status as an icon. The collaboration with Maître Gims on the hit ‘Sapés comme Jamais’ perfectly illustrates this creative synergy, where Niska’s atypical physique harmoniously complements his presence in the media landscape.
Niska’s journey is also marked by musical awards that attest to his success and recognition by his peers. The accolades at the Victoires de la Musique and the W9 d’Or de la Musique highlight a career filled with brilliance and public resonance. These distinctions, far from being ends in themselves, seal the relevance of his work in the French music scene.
His participation as a jury member on the show ‘Rhythm + Flow: Nouvelle École’ showcases the extent of his influence, where Niska shares his expertise and experience with the new wave of artists. This media involvement, coupled with notable performances like that at the Mawazine Festival, confirms the aura surrounding the artist and his role as a mentor for the rising generations of French rap.
